Hellas Sports Construction to renovate Angelo State University sports complex


Austin-based Hellas Sports Construction has secured a $1.2 million project from the Texas Tech University System Board of Regents to renovate the LeGrand Sports Complex of the Angelo State University in Texas.


To be renamed after 1st Community Federal Credit Union, the new sports centre will become the future home of Angelo State University's Rams.

As per the contract, a new multipurpose synthetic MatrixTurf field and epiQ TRACKS track system will be installed in the facility. Upon completion, the MatrixTurf field will provide a better surface for the athletes.

The comprehensive scope on the project includes the repositioning of the field events like moving of the long and triple jump, pole vault runways and javelin apron to put them in viewer- friendly location, which will enhance the atmosphere during home track meets.

The new sports facility is scheduled to open its doors to the spectators in 1 October 2013.
